  • Quote from: Ted Maysfield
    "My problem with him is that he is pretty much a sedevacantist but doesn’t admit it. If you look at his characterizations of the Church under the past three popes as “newchurch” this is not hard to see. He believes the strict observance of the SSPX is the Church; and the pope, cardinals and bishops are something else, heretic “newchurch." That is sedevacantism."


    Quote from: Matamoros
    No you need to look at what the SSPX means by expressions like "Conciliar Church" or "Newchurch". They're talking, not about a separate jusrisdiction which they don't recognise, or another church, but that section of the Catholic Church (most of it) which is imbued with a new spirit which they reject. Archbishop Lefebvre went to Rome; Bishop Williamson has been to Rome. Whatever one may think of their views, they recognise the Pope, and are not sedevacantists. Bishop Williamson can't end up in the same boat as Dolan, because they don't agree.
